      Meaning of the first name Fionnua

      Origin

      Irish

      Meaning

      White or Fair-haired

      Variations

      Fionnuala, Fionnualagh, Fionnula
      The name Fionnua is of Irish origin, deriving from the Gaelic word fionn, which means white or fair-haired. This name embodies qualities associated with lightness and brightness, often linked to purity and innocence. In Irish culture, names frequently reflect characteristics of nature, and Fionnua's meaning aligns with traditional values that celebrate physical attributes as representations of personality and spirit.

      Fionnua has historical significance in Irish mythology and folklore. The name's roots can be traced back to ancient tales, where it is often associated with figures possessing notable wisdom and beauty. Throughout various periods in Irish history, names like Fionnua were used among noble families and were sometimes linked to legendary heroes or mythic characters, underscoring the importance of lineage and honor in Irish society. As with many Irish names, Fionnua carries a legacy that connects individuals to their ancestral heritage.

      In contemporary times, Fionnua remains a unique choice for parents seeking a name that reflects Irish identity and cultural heritage. While not as common as some other Irish names, it has gained attention among those who appreciate its distinct sound and meaning. Fionnua is sometimes adapted into various forms, ensuring its continued relevance in modern naming practices. As global interest in Irish culture grows, names like Fionnua are increasingly regarded as attractive options that offer both tradition and individuality.
